How to see it
HIP 90501 has a visual magnitude of about 7.93: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.
Sky position
Equatorial coordinates for HIP 90501: right ascension 18h 28m 3s, declination −63° 18′ 48″ (J2000), in the region of the Pavo constellation (IAU figure Pav).
